Are you looking to take your athletic performance to the next level? Have you considered trying the carnivore diet? Many athletes have reported significant improvements in their endurance, strength, and overall fitness by following a meat-based diet.

The carnivore diet, also known as the zero carb or low carbohydrate diet, focuses on consuming animal foods exclusively. By eliminating all plant-based products, many athletes have found that they have more energy, quicker recovery times, and increased muscle mass.

Benefits of the Carnivore Diet for Athletes:

  • Improved endurance and stamina
  • Enhanced muscle growth and recovery
  • Increased mental clarity and focus
  • Reduced inflammation and joint pain

Tips for Success:

1. Prioritize high-quality, grass-fed meats for optimal nutrition.

2. Experiment with different cuts of meat to ensure you’re getting a variety of nutrients.

3. Stay hydrated and consider incorporating electrolytes to support your active lifestyle.
